Douglas, 80, suffered a minor stroke in 1996, the year in which he won an honorary Oscar for 50 years of achievement in the film industry. The festival, running Oct. 14-19, will showcase new movies made outside the studio system. More than 200 movies have been submitted for competition. It doesn't, however, mean he'll be staying either. The actor put his extravagant 11.7-acre bayfront estate on the market Monday with a $27.5 million asking price that would easily rank it South Florida's most expensive private home. Jacobson said Stallone wants to ``downsize'' and was considering other homes in Miami, Miami Beach and elsewhere in South Florida for himself and his wife, model Jennifer Flavin, and their 4-year-old daughter, Sophia Rose. ``He loves Miami and the Miami Beach area,'' Jacobson said. ``He's more of a family man now and feels like all this is perhaps something that he doesn't need anymore.'' ``All this'' is an awful lot: The estate - originally part of the vast James Deering compound, Villa Vizcaya - includes a 4-bedroom, 9-1/2-bath, 24,000-square-foot main house with a ballroom that features an orchestra loft and ceiling frescoes, a mini-movie theater and, naturally, a killer gym; three guesthouses; a security gatehouse equipped with military microwave gear and infrared cameras; Olympic pool, lush tropical landscaping; and a boat house with four docking slips and space for a 100-foot yacht. To that end, the movie also stars Kris Kristofferson, Randy Travis, Travis Tritt, Marty Stuart, Patsy and Peggy Lynn plus Levon Helm, who organized the band and will also make the tour. The Nashville performance Sept. 4 will be carried live on The Nashville Network.
